In the Comic Book In the Movie
   The Comic starts with Mindy training Dave on his fighting skills In the movie Dave's doesn't know what to do with his life and later he asks Mindy to train him.
   Marcus discovers all the weapons that Mindy was hiding in his room and makes her promise to never be Hit-girl again for her mother's safety. Marcus discovers blood in her face and makes her promise to never be Hit-Girl again for him, because her mother is dead in the movies.
   Mindy is about 10-12 years old. Mindy is about 14-15 years old
   This doesn't happen in the comics, his mother is alive. Chris accidentally kills his mother while she was taking a tan in a Tan Machine
   She doesn't dump Dave because she is never his girlfriend. Katie Deauxma dumps Dave after she discovers Dave and Mindy fighting in the hallway.
